Deer enters an Ohio bar
People in Ohio were left scratching their heads after a deer crashed into a bar and scrambled across the floor last week.
A video captured last Friday’s incident.
The video shows a deer running into the bar around 2:30 p.m.
While people can be seen moving to safety, one person tries to open a door for the deer.
That person is then seen running out of the bar with the deer behind him.
Besides some damage to the window, tables, and chairs, no injuries were reported.
Flying Snakes - Chrysopelea
Chrysopelea, or more commonly known as the flying snake, is a genus that belongs to the family Colubridae. Flying snakes are mildly venomous,though they are considered harmless because their toxicity is not dangerous to humans. Their range of habitat is mostly concentrated in Southeast Asia, the Melanesian islands, and India.

Weatherman vs Pelican - LIVE
Aussie weatherman Steven Jacobs didn't know one of his vocational hazards would be a pelican attack.
Broadcasting from the Taronga Zoo in Sydney, Jacobs was in the middle of his report recently when a pelican named Marnie began repeatedly biting his backside.
Jacobs, of Nine Network Australia, joked on "The Early Show" that he has no idea what provoked the behavior, but it could have been the fish he’d eaten the night before.

The World's Largest Snake
Indonesian villagers claim to have captured a python that is almost 49 feet long and weighs nearly 990 pounds, a local official said.
If confirmed, it would be the largest snake ever kept in captivity.
Hundreds of people have flocked to see the snake at a primitive zoo in Curugsewu village on the country’s main island of Java.
Local government official Rachmat said the reticulated python measured 48 feet 8 inches and weighed in at 983 pounds.
The Guinness Book of World Records lists the longest ever captured snake to be 32 feet. The heaviest — a Burmese Python kept in Gurnee, Ill. — weighs 402 pounds, the book said on its Web site.

Demolition of Chimney
The former Ohio Edison Mad River Power Plant's 275-foot smoke stack crushes surrounding buildings as it falls the wrong way during its demolition Wednesday, Nov. 10.
“Oh no.”
Those were some of the last words heard before shouts to get back as the old Mad River Power Plant’s 275-foot tower toppled in the wrong direction about noon Wednesday.
The blasts should have sent the stack onto a cleared area directly to the east, but instead the tower crashed to the southeast.
No one was injured but the tower knocked down two 12,500-volt power lines and smashed a building housing back-up generators.

Building Collapse - Demolition Fail
Demolition is the tearing-down of buildings and other structures, the opposite of construction. Demolition contrasts with deconstruction, which involves taking a building apart while carefully preserving valuable elements for re-use.
